Buying Guide for Yamaha Golf Cart Tires

Understanding Your Yamaha Golf Cart Needs

When I first looked for new tires for my Yamaha golf cart, I realized that knowing the type of terrain I usually drive on is crucial. Whether it’s smooth golf course paths, rugged trails, or urban streets, the tire type must match the environment to ensure safety and performance.

Choosing the Right Tire Size

I found that checking the existing tire size on my Yamaha golf cart was the first step. The size is usually printed on the sidewall of the tire. Sticking to the recommended size helps maintain proper handling and avoids issues with clearance or suspension.

Considering Tire Tread Patterns

The tread pattern makes a big difference depending on where you drive. I opted for turf tires when on grassy golf courses because they provide good grip without damaging the grass. For off-road or rough terrain, more aggressive tread patterns offer better traction.

Material and Durability

I looked into tires made from quality rubber compounds that offer durability and resistance to wear and tear. A durable tire saves money in the long run by reducing the frequency of replacements, especially if you use your cart frequently.

Load Capacity and Weight Rating

It’s important to consider how much weight your golf cart carries. I checked the load capacity rating of the tires to ensure they can handle the combined weight of the cart, passengers, and any cargo. This helps prevent tire failure and improves overall safety.

Tube vs. Tubeless Tires

I learned that Yamaha golf carts can use either tube or tubeless tires. Tubeless tires are generally easier to repair and maintain, but tube tires might be more common depending on the model. Knowing which type your cart uses helps in making the right purchase.

Weather and Seasonal Considerations

Depending on where I live, weather conditions affected my choice. Some tires perform better in wet or muddy conditions, while others are designed for dry, warm climates. Selecting tires suited for your typical weather ensures better control and longevity.

Budget and Warranty

I balanced my budget with quality by looking for tires that offered good value without compromising safety. Also, checking if the tires come with a warranty gave me added confidence in my purchase.

Installation and Maintenance Tips

Finally, I made sure to have the tires installed by a professional or follow proper guidelines if doing it myself. Regular maintenance like checking tire pressure and inspecting for wear helps keep the tires performing well and extends their lifespan.
